Question to the Home Office:

To ask the Secretary of State for the Home Department, how many investigations there have been into the fraudulent sale of (a) houses and (b) powers where a power of attorney has been used in each police force area; and if she will make a statement.

The Home Office collects information on the number of fraud offences that the National Fraud Intelligence Bureau refer to police forces for investigation but breakdowns specifically for those relating to fraudulent sales of houses are not separately identifiable. This data is published annually as part of the Home Office’s ‘Crime Outcomes in England and Wales’ publication. The latest available data for year ending March 2020 can be found be here:

https://www.gov.uk/government/collections/crime-outcomes-in-england-and-wales-statistics

Related data on investigations where the use of a power of attorney has been involved is not held centrally.
